Risto Kalevi Siilasmaa is a Finnish businessman, the chairman, founder and former CEO of F-Secure Corporation (formerly Data Fellows), an antivirus and computer security software company based in Helsinki, Finland. He is also the largest shareholder of F-Secure, owning about 40% of the company. From 2012 to 2020, he was the chairman of Nokia.

Siilasmaa joined the board of Nokia in 2008. After being named Nokia's chairman in mid-2012, he served as interim CEO, succeeding Stephen Elop, from 3 September 2013 to 29 April 2014, when Rajeev Suri was appointed as the official CEO. Since then, he has led the company through one of the most successful corporate transformations ever. Through three transactions he negotiated—the purchase of full ownership of Nokia Siemens Networks, the sale of the handset business to Microsoft, and the acquisition of Alcatel-Lucent—Nokia became a successful global technology leader. This is also reflected in the value of Nokia, which has increased fivefold in roughly two years. Even more telling, the company's value rose to over €20 billion shortly after Siilasmaa took over as chairman. In a September 2018 interview with CNN in Switzerland, he described Nokia as an "experimenter."

In October 2018, Siilasmaa published a book about Nokia, Transforming Nokia: The Power of Paranoid Optimism to Lead Through Colossal Change. In it, he criticizes the leadership style of his predecessor, President Jorma Ollila, and claimed that they fell out. In December 2019, Siilasmaa announced that he would step down as chairman of Nokia's board, to be succeeded by Sari Baldauf as vice chairman in 2020.

During Nokia's transformation, Siilasmaa also renewed the board and management, and the vast majority of employees newly joined the new phase of the company. Siilasmaa has often stated that every atom in Nokia has changed, but the spirit of the 150-year-old company lives on.

Nokia once dominated the smartphone industry. It was to cell phones what Kleenex was to facial tissues. Then iPhones and Androids came out of nowhere and pushed Nokia off the cliff. In just four years, the company lost more than 90 percent of its value. Revenues were in freefall; mass layoffs became common. Experts predicted that bankruptcy was not a matter of if, but when.

Then something equally shocking happened. In record time, Nokia rebounded. With a vengeance. Nokia reinvented itself to become the second largest player in the $100 billion global wireless market. In Transforming Nokia, the man who orchestrated and led Nokia's comeback, Chairman Risto Siilasmaa, reveals the story of Nokia's fall and rise.
